[프로그래머스/Kotlin] 짝수의 합 (Lv. 0)
·
Algorithm/kotlin
문제 정수 n이 주어질 때, n이하의 짝수를 모두 더한 값을 return 하도록 solution 함수를 작성해주세요. 제한사항 0 n ≤ 1000 입출력 예 코드class Solution { fun solution(n: Int): Int { var answer: Int = 0 for(i in 2..n step 2){ answer += i } return answer }} 기록하고 싶은 부분위의 문제는 짝수의 합을 구하는 문제라서 반복문을 돌릴 때 짝수의 개수만큼만 돌려주는게 효율적이다.step n을 사용하면 반복을 반으로 줄일 수 있다 ! 반복문을 실행할 때 조건이 들어가야한다면step n ..과 until의 차이for(..